Profile of the degree program
The part-time Master's degree course in Business Administration enables working people to complete an academic education with the internationally recognized degree "Master of Business Administration MBA" while working. The program is aimed at people who require knowledge of decision-oriented business administration due to their professional situation or career planning.

Course content and schedule
Module study
Individual modules can also be taken from the degree program. Upon successful completion of the module examination, you automatically acquire the corresponding number of credit points. These are recognized as a partial qualification for later admission to a full degree course. The modular study program thus enables gradual entry into a degree program or its gradual continuation by earning credit points.
Study organization
The course is timetabled and organized to suit the needs of working students. The courses take place in one block week and on approximately five Saturdays per semester.
Course content
The degree program imparts sound business management knowledge to people who are increasingly entrusted with business management tasks. This includes in particular
- Models of the company and the economy as a whole
- Business management methods subjects such as strategic and operational planning, investment and decision-making, organization and controlling
- Transfer-oriented methods such as projects, computer-based business games, best practice examples
- General education subjects such as economic history and economic theory
- Guest lectures by experts from the business world
If necessary, bridging courses can be offered for participants who have not studied business administration but have business administration-related professional tasks.
Costs and financing
According to the Bavarian Higher Education Innovation Act (BayHIG), Coburg University of Applied Sciences is obliged to charge a fee to cover the costs of part-time degree programs. The total cost of the course is 15,680 euros.
The fees include the costs for course materials and electronic platforms. In addition, the current student union fee (including semester ticket) is charged per semester.
Expenses for continuing education are tax-deductible. As a cooperative program between a university and a company, tuition fees can be partially or fully covered by the company. Our Career Service provides information on other options for financing your studies and scholarships.
Job & Career
The course is a cooperative development between companies in the region and Coburg University of Applied Sciences. Particularly qualified employees are given the opportunity to study while working. The companies want to meet the increasing demand for specialists and managers. However, this path of further education is also open to prospective students who want to study independently of their companies.
